OpenSearchResourceConfig.Builder |
OpenSearchResourceConfig.Builder.applicationArn(String applicationArn) |
If you want to use an existing OpenSearch Service application for your integration with OpenSearch Service,
specify it here.
|
static OpenSearchResourceConfig.Builder |
OpenSearchResourceConfig.builder() |
|
OpenSearchResourceConfig.Builder |
OpenSearchResourceConfig.Builder.dashboardViewerPrincipals(String... dashboardViewerPrincipals) |
Specify the ARNs of IAM roles and IAM users who you want to grant permission to for viewing the dashboards.
|
OpenSearchResourceConfig.Builder |
OpenSearchResourceConfig.Builder.dashboardViewerPrincipals(Collection<String> dashboardViewerPrincipals) |
Specify the ARNs of IAM roles and IAM users who you want to grant permission to for viewing the dashboards.
|
OpenSearchResourceConfig.Builder |
OpenSearchResourceConfig.Builder.dataSourceRoleArn(String dataSourceRoleArn) |
Specify the ARN of an IAM role that CloudWatch Logs will use to create the integration.
|
OpenSearchResourceConfig.Builder |
OpenSearchResourceConfig.Builder.kmsKeyArn(String kmsKeyArn) |
To have the vended dashboard data encrypted with KMS instead of the CloudWatch Logs default encryption
method, specify the ARN of the KMS key that you want to use.
|
OpenSearchResourceConfig.Builder |
OpenSearchResourceConfig.Builder.retentionDays(Integer retentionDays) |
Specify how many days that you want the data derived by OpenSearch Service to be retained in the index that
the dashboard refers to.
|
OpenSearchResourceConfig.Builder |
OpenSearchResourceConfig.toBuilder() |
|